Occultation UUID [and DB] : 58691450-46b3-4c44-a322-4c96c9f177f1 [observed] Occultation Date + Time : 2021-07-15 at 21:44:30 UT +/- 0.01 min [1] Object Designation : (159) Aemilia Orbit Class : MBA Star Designation : GDR3 4087127819909254272 Star Coordinates (ICRF) : RA = 19 06 58.1460, DE = -18 41 56.116 [2] Star Magnitudes : G = 10.84 mag, RP = 9.72 mag, BP = 12.12 mag Object Magnitude : V = 13.2 mag Estimated Magnitude Drop : 2.5 mag Estimated Max. Duration : 8.9 sec Object Mean Diameter : 125 km (src: astorb) Speed of the shadow : 14.0 km/s Elongation to Moon & Sun : 101° (sunlit = 33%), Sun = 171° Cross-track uncertainty : 0.7 mas = 1 km = 0.01 path-width (1-sig) RUWE and duplicate source : 0.87 mas, dup.src = 0 (0:false, 1:true) Ephemeris Reference : JPL#122 [1] time t0 of closest geocentric approach c/a, [2] including proper motion until t0 |
